What a nerve block really does

A nerve block is the injection of a local anesthetic, sometimes with a corticosteroid or other adjunct, around a specific nerve, nerve root, or plexus to interrupt pain signaling. Local anesthetics like lidocaine or bupivacaine temporarily stabilize nerve membranes. That blockade can quiet peripheral pain generators, calm inflamed nerve roots, or reset a sympathetic circuit that has been amplifying pain.

The goals vary by scenario:

    Diagnostic: numb a structure to see if pain fades, which helps a pain diagnosis doctor confirm the source. If a medial branch block reduces back pain by 80 percent for a few hours, facet joints likely drive the symptoms. Therapeutic: deliver sustained relief by treating inflammation or interrupting a pain loop. An occipital nerve block can settle migraine flares for weeks. Prognostic: forecast the response to a longer acting procedure. If genicular nerve blocks help knee pain, radiofrequency ablation of those same nerves may deliver months of value.

Although the term nerve block sounds singular, techniques differ widely. A pain injection doctor will choose medications, volumes, and approach based on the tissue target and risk profile.

How a pain management physician decides who benefits

Successful blocks start with thorough evaluation. An experienced pain specialist listens for clues: sharp and dermatomal pain that zings down a leg hints at a lumbar nerve root problem, deep aching made worse with extension points toward facet joints, and stocking glove numbness begs the question of neuropathy rather than a focal entrapment. Physical exam adds more: reproduction of pain with facet loading, Tinel’s over a peripheral nerve, weakness that maps to a specific root, or temperature change that suggests sympathetic involvement.

Imaging helps, but only when interpreted in context. Many people over 40 carry MRI findings that look dramatic yet do not hurt. A pain management specialist ties pictures to symptoms. For a patient with left L5 radicular pain and a matching small lateral disc herniation at L4-5, a selective L5 transforaminal epidural injection can be both diagnostic and therapeutic. For nonradiating midline back pain with normal MRI, facet blocks or sacroiliac testing might be more informative.

Medications and comorbidities shape timing and technique. Anticoagulation influences whether a block proceeds or waits. Diabetes raises concern for steroid related glucose spikes, so a non steroid or low dose plan may be safer. A pregnancy prompts ultrasound guidance and steroid avoidance. A pain care doctor adjusts all those levers before a needle ever touches skin.

Imaging guidance is not optional

An interventional pain doctor rarely works blind. Fluoroscopy, ultrasound, and CT make blocks safer and more accurate. Fluoroscopy excels for spine procedures: the operator can see bony landmarks, epidural spread, and contrast patterns that warn of intravascular uptake. Ultrasound shines for superficial peripheral nerves, allows real time visualization of the needle tip and surrounding vessels, and avoids radiation. CT, while less common in the clinic, is a problem solver for deep or anatomically distorted targets like the celiac plexus in a patient with prior surgery.

Why the insistence on imaging? Because millimeters matter. A misplaced injection can fail outright or cause harm. Contrast under fluoroscopy revealing venous uptake during a transforaminal epidural prompts immediate repositioning. Ultrasound showing a nerve sliding away from the injectate tells the operator to redirect to achieve a circumferential spread. Common targets and what they treat

Spine related pain dominates clinical practice. A back pain specialist doctor sees a steady stream of sciatica, facet arthropathy, and sacroiliac joint pain. Peripheral nerve entrapments, sympathetically maintained pain, and headache disorders fill the rest of an interventional pain schedule. Here is how a pain treatment doctor thinks through the options.

Lumbar and cervical epidural injections. These deliver anesthetic and often corticosteroid into the epidural space. The transforaminal route targets a specific nerve root near the foramen, useful for unilateral radicular pain. The interlaminar approach bathes a broader region. When disc herniation or foraminal stenosis inflames a nerve, a precisely placed epidural injection can reduce pain substantially for weeks to a few months. For select patients, two to three injections over a year can control flares while the underlying disc settles.

Medial branch blocks for facet pain. Facet joints in the neck and low back can cause deep, aching pain that worsens with extension or prolonged standing. A pain management physician blocks the small medial branch nerves that supply those joints. If relief exceeds a set threshold, usually at least 50 to 80 percent for the duration of the anesthetic, that positive test opens the door to radiofrequency ablation. A radiofrequency ablation doctor then cauterizes the same nerves, often yielding 6 to 12 months of improved function.

Sacroiliac joint injections. While not a pure nerve block, SI joint injections target the inflamed synovial portion of the joint and can ease buttock pain that worsens with standing, stair climbing, or rolling in bed. Diagnostic relief guides further steps, including lateral branch radiofrequency techniques.

Occipital nerve blocks. A headache specialist doctor uses these for occipital neuralgia and as an adjunct in chronic migraine. Injecting a small volume around the greater and lesser occipital nerves can lower attack frequency and intensity. I have seen patients reduce triptan use by half after a short series.

Peripheral entrapments. The carpal tunnel gets press, but pain doctors frequently address lateral femoral cutaneous nerve irritation, ilioinguinal and genitofemoral neuralgia after hernia repair, or sural nerve pain after ankle trauma. Ultrasound guidance has made these blocks more reliable by visualizing fascial planes and pathologic swelling.

Genicular nerve blocks for knee pain. For patients with knee osteoarthritis who are poor surgical candidates or wish to defer replacement, genicular nerve blocks provide diagnostic clarity. A strong response supports genicular radiofrequency ablation. Relief rates of 50 to 70 percent at 6 months are common in well selected patients.

Sympathetic blocks. The stellate ganglion block can help complex regional pain syndrome of the upper extremity or certain refractory facial pain conditions. Lumbar sympathetic blocks assist with lower limb CRPS or ischemic pain. Timing matters; earlier intervention in CRPS correlates with better outcomes.

Pudendal and pelvic nerve blocks. Pelvic pain is complex. A pain disorder specialist works closely with pelvic floor therapists and gynecology or urology colleagues. Targeted blocks can interrupt a pain spiral enough to allow progress with therapy.

Plexus and visceral blocks. A celiac plexus block or neurolysis can reduce severe abdominal pain from pancreatic cancer. A superior hypogastric plexus block targets pelvic cancer pain. Here, the interventional pain specialist balances analgesia against side effects like hypotension or diarrhea, with careful preprocedure hydration and monitoring.

Diagnostic clarity before escalation

A nerve block that provides short lived relief is not a failure if it confirms the pain source. That information prevents unnecessary surgery and points to durable interventions. For example, a patient with axial low back pain failed months of therapy and medications. MRI showed mild changes that did not lock down a diagnosis. Two sets of medial branch blocks, each with different anesthetics to reduce placebo bias, both relieved pain by more than 80 percent for the expected duration. That evidence justified proceeding to radiofrequency ablation, which gave 10 months of improved activity without opioids.

Similarly, selective nerve root blocks help confirm the symptomatic level when multilevel stenosis clouds the picture. An interventional pain specialist avoids guessing. When relief follows a targeted root injection, the odds of success with decompression surgery or focused RFA climb.

The quiet work of risk reduction

Most nerve blocks carry low complication rates when performed by a trained pain procedure doctor using sterile technique and imaging. That does not mean risk free. Infection, bleeding, nerve injury, allergic reaction, and local anesthetic systemic toxicity remain on the checklist. There are also block specific issues: hoarseness and a transient Horner’s syndrome after a stellate ganglion block, temporary leg heaviness after a lumbar sympathetic block, or a blood sugar spike after a steroid containing epidural.

A pain management provider mitigates these risks with planning. Anticoagulation is managed according to society guidelines. Platelet function and renal disease are considered. Diabetics are counseled on glucose monitoring for a few days if steroids are used. For patients struggling with anxiety about injections, a pain care specialist can pair minimal sedation with clear communication and the option to pause. Good technique includes incremental injection with frequent aspiration, contrast testing under fluoroscopy, and constant ultrasound visualization of the needle tip during peripheral blocks.

What to expect on the day of a block

Patients often ask whether a nerve block hurts. With topical anesthetic and deliberate infiltration, discomfort is brief for most procedures. After check in and a review of meds, the pain management consultant marks targets, confirms consent, and moves to the procedure suite. A nurse monitors blood pressure, heart rate, and oxygen saturation. For spine procedures, fluoroscopy guides needle placement. For peripheral nerves, ultrasound mapping comes first. The doctor injects a small test dose to confirm spread, then the planned anesthetic, with or without steroid. Most visits end with a short recovery and a ride home. Walking the same day is typical.

When the block is diagnostic, patients leave with a pain diary. The task is simple: record relief at set intervals for 6 to 8 hours, then again the next day. That timeline helps a pain evaluation doctor distinguish the anesthetic phase from any steroid effect. Those details drive the next step.

Integrating blocks into a broader plan

A nerve block alone rarely solves a complex pain disorder. The best outcomes come from a multidisciplinary plan. Physical therapy builds capacity while pain is quieted. Cognitive behavioral strategies reduce catastrophizing and improve coping. A non opioid pain doctor optimizes medications such as SNRIs for neuropathic pain, topical agents, or carefully titrated anticonvulsants. When opioids appear, they do so with caution and with clear goals and exit strategies.

An interventional sequence often unfolds like this: a diagnostic block identifies a target, therapeutic injections stabilize the flare, and a longer acting option, such as radiofrequency ablation, advances durability. For refractory radicular pain after back surgery, a spinal cord stimulator doctor may discuss neuromodulation. A stimulator is not a first line tool, but for neuropathic leg pain that resists injections and revision surgery, modern systems can return meaningful quality of life.

Two brief case snapshots

A teacher with stubborn migraines. She averaged 12 headache days a month despite triptans and preventive medication. Examination found tenderness over the greater occipital nerves. An ultrasound guided occipital nerve block with a small volume of local anesthetic and corticosteroid reduced her monthly headache days to 6 for three months. That window allowed her neurologist to adjust preventives and start a neck strengthening program. Repeat blocks every 3 to 4 months kept her under 8 days monthly, and she avoided escalation to injectable CGRP therapy.

A construction worker with knee osteoarthritis. He wanted to keep working and was not ready for total knee replacement. After a trial of physical therapy and a single cortisone injection with only brief benefit, a genicular nerve doctor performed diagnostic genicular blocks at three targets. Pain fell by 70 percent for the day. Two weeks later, genicular radiofrequency ablation extended relief for 9 months. He returned to full duty with a brace and a home program, and repeated RFA at the 10 month mark when pain crept back.

Where nerve blocks fit relative to surgery and medication

For focal pain driven by inflammation or entrapment, a nerve block can outperform systemic medication by delivering high local concentration with fewer whole body effects. For widespread pain such as fibromyalgia, a fibromyalgia specialist will not lean on blocks outside of focal myofascial trigger point injections. For structural problems that compress nerves severely, injections help as a bridge but cannot replace decompression.

Special situations and how strategy shifts

Diabetes. A non surgical pain specialist limits steroid dose and frequency, uses glucose sparingly in contrast, and coordinates with primary care for postprocedural glucose checks. For neuropathic foot pain, blocks have a limited role outside focal entrapments, so a chronic pain specialist emphasizes medications and neuromodulation options.

Anticoagulation. The balance between bleeding and thrombosis risk drives timing. Epidural and deep plexus blocks usually require holding certain anticoagulants, while many superficial ultrasound guided peripheral blocks can proceed with careful technique.

Older adults. Fragile skin, spinal stenosis, and polypharmacy complicate the picture. An integrative pain specialist often pairs low volume, low steroid dose injections with gentle physical therapy, vitamin D assessment, and fall risk reduction. Relief that restores walking tolerance from 5 to 20 minutes changes lives more than pain scores do.

Athletes and workers in safety sensitive roles. A pain relief doctor clears return to play or duty with caution. A long acting weak motor block near a critical nerve can pose risk. Here, minimal volume, careful positioning, and activity guidance matter.

Pregnancy. Avoidance of steroid and limiting radiation shape choices. Ultrasound guided peripheral blocks and certain trigger point injections support function while obstetrics manages the larger plan.

What durability looks like in the real world

The honest answer is that relief spans a range. For epidural injections treating radiculopathy, patients often experience meaningful relief for 2 to 12 weeks. Some earn a reprieve that lasts longer if the underlying disc edema settles. For radiofrequency ablation after successful medial branch blocks, 6 to 12 months is typical, with repeat procedures restoring benefit as nerves regrow. Occipital nerve blocks for migraine may reduce attack frequency for 4 to 8 weeks in many, longer for some. Genicular RFA often buys 6 to 9 months.

Sustained benefit depends on using the window wisely. When pain lifts, a rehabilitation pain doctor advances core work, hip hinges, and gait training. A pain therapy doctor may taper medications that cause brain fog or constipation. Sleep improves. Mood follows. The block is the door opener, not the entire house.

When a block is not the answer

Not all pain syndromes respond to focal interventions. Widespread myalgia, central sensitization, and poorly defined axial pain without reproducible triggers often disappoint when treated with blocks alone. A holistic pain doctor spends more time on sleep, graded exercise, mindfulness, and carefully selected medications. A simple framework for deciding your next step

    If your pain maps to a specific nerve or joint, and exam reproduces it in a focal way, a targeted nerve block by a pain relief physician is a reasonable next move. If imaging shows a clear pain generator that matches your symptoms, consider a diagnostic block to confirm before any definitive procedure. If pain is widespread or primarily central, prioritize rehabilitation, behavioral strategies, and medication optimization, with blocks reserved for distinct hot spots. If a block gives strong but temporary relief, discuss longer acting options like radiofrequency ablation or, for neuropathic limb pain, neuromodulation. If red flags appear, such as rapidly progressive weakness, fever with spinal pain, or changes in bladder function, seek urgent evaluation rather than a routine block.
